Key actions include creating, deleting, and retrieving photo sequence metadata. `CreatePhotoSequence` extracts 360 photos from video or XDM data after upload. `Delete` removes the `PhotoSequence` and its metadata. `Get` retrieves metadata through the `Operation` interface. `startUpload` initializes an upload session for photo sequence data.
